What's The Definition Of Yaqui?
Yaqui in American English
noun: a member of an indigenous people of Sonora, Mexico Yaqui in British English noun: a river in NW Mexico, rising near the border with the US and flowing south to the Gulf of California. Length: about 676 km (420 miles) |
